IEHP is a health plan dedicated to serving low-income individuals and families in Riverside and San Bernardino counties. They offer a variety of programs including Medi-Cal, DualChoice, and Covered California, providing healthcare coverage for residents who may not otherwise have access to necessary medical services. With a focus on holistic health and community wellness, IEHP partners with local doctors and facilities to ensure comprehensive care for their members, supporting them with resources in mental health, fitness classes, and wellness education.

📋 Description

• Find joy in serving others with IEHP! • Reporting to the Director of Finance Analytics, the Finance Commercial Operations Manager is responsible for the management and oversight of daily Covered California financial operations and reporting, premium billing activities, commission payments, and monitoring of third-party vendors that impact financial activities. • This position also reviews monthly revenue reconciliation reports and data, reviews and approves grace period/termination/suspended member notifications, and reviews and recommend updates to financial policies for Covered California • Commitment to Quality: The IEHP Team is committed to incorporate IEHP’s Quality Program goals including, but not limited to, HEDIS, CAHPS, and NCQA Accreditation.

🎯 Requirements

• Minimum of five (5) years of relevant managed care, premium billing, and/or other related experience • A minimum of two (2) years in a supervisory capacity • In lieu of supervisory experience, a Master's degree in a related field from an accredited institution or CPA License is required • Bachelor's degree in Finance, Business Administration, Economics, Health Care Administration, Accounting, or other related field from an accredited institution required • Master’s degree from an accredited institution preferred • Strong knowledge and understanding in the following areas: Generally accepted accounting principles (GAAP) and the practical application of general accounting theory • Commercial health plan billing practices • Proficiency in Microsoft Office with advanced Excel skills • Excellent problem-solving skills and strong analytical skills • Demonstrated leadership and ability to mentor and train subordinates • Proficiency in Microsoft Office with advanced Excel skills • Proven ability to: Lead a high performing team • Possess a high attention to detail • Communicate effectively at all organizational levels both orally and written
